Universitas Jambi, often abbreviated as UNJA, stands as a prominent public university in Indonesia's Sumatra region. Located in Jambi Province, it plays a vital role in higher education, offering diverse jobs at Universitas Jambi that attract academics, researchers, and administrators. Established in 1963, the institution has evolved into a hub for education and innovation, focusing on fields relevant to Indonesia's tropical environment and economic needs. Jobs here range from teaching lecturer positions to cutting-edge research roles, providing opportunities for professionals passionate about contributing to Southeast Asian academia.

The university's main campus in Jambi city spans a lush, expansive area conducive to learning and research. With nine faculties, including Teacher Training and Education, Economics and Business, Law, Agriculture, Engineering, Medicine, Mathematics and Natural Sciences, Psychology, and Social Sciences, UNJA supports a broad spectrum of academic pursuits. 🎓 History and Overview of Universitas Jambi

Founded on August 23, 1963, Universitas Jambi began as a branch of Universitas Sriwijaya before gaining independence. Initially offering limited programs, it expanded rapidly in the 1980s and 1990s, incorporating vocational and postgraduate studies. Today, it enrolls over 30,000 students and employs thousands of staff, underscoring its growth in providing jobs at Universitas Jambi.

Key milestones include the establishment of its medical faculty in 2011 and engineering programs emphasizing sustainable technologies. The university's vision emphasizes 'excellent, innovative, and superior' education, aligning with Indonesia's national development goals. This commitment fosters a dynamic job market for faculty who can blend teaching with community-engaged research, such as studies on palm oil sustainability or public health in rural Sumatra.

  • 1963: Official founding as a public institution.
  • 1980s: Expansion to multiple faculties.
  • 2000s: Introduction of doctoral programs.
  • Present: International collaborations boosting research jobs.

🔬 Definitions of Key Terms in UNJA Jobs

To understand jobs at Universitas Jambi fully, key Indonesian academic terms include:

  • Dosen: Lecturer or professor responsible for teaching, research, and service (Tri Dharma Perguruan Tinggi).
  • S1/S2/S3: Bachelor's (Sarjana), Master's (Magister), and Doctoral (Doktor) degrees, with S3 typically required for senior lecturer roles.
  • Luaran Tridharma: Outputs from teaching (teaching), research (penelitian), and community service (pengabdian masyarakat).
  • PNS: Pegawai Negeri Sipil (civil servant status), offering job security for permanent faculty.

These terms define the core expectations for academic positions, ensuring hires contribute holistically to the university's mission.

📋 Required Academic Qualifications, Research Focus, Experience, and Skills

Jobs at Universitas Jambi demand rigorous qualifications. For lecturer (dosen) roles:

  • Academic Qualifications: Minimum S2 (master's) for junior lecturers; PhD (S3) mandatory for associate and full professors, especially in sciences and engineering.
  • Research Focus: Priority in agriculture (palm oil, fisheries), environmental science, renewable energy, public health, and digital economy, reflecting Jambi's rubber and oil industries.
  • Preferred Experience: 5+ years teaching, 5-10 Scopus-indexed publications, grant funding from LPDP or national bodies, and international conference presentations.
  • Skills and Competencies: Proficiency in Indonesian and English, data analysis tools (SPSS, GIS), grant writing, curriculum development, and interdisciplinary collaboration.

Administrative jobs require bachelor's degrees with experience in higher ed management. Research assistants need S1 with lab skills. These align with Indonesia's KKNI (Indonesian National Qualifications Framework), ensuring global competitiveness.

💼 Types of Positions and Career Paths

Common jobs at Universitas Jambi include:

  • Lecturer/Professor: Teaching core courses and supervising theses.
  • Researcher/Postdoc: Leading projects on sustainable agriculture; see research jobs.
  • Administrative Staff: HR, finance, student affairs.
  • Lab Technicians: Supporting engineering and medical research.

Career progression follows civil servant ranks (golongan), from Asisten Ahli to Lektor Kepala, with promotions based on performance metrics. For faculty paths, visit faculty jobs.

🌈 Diversity and Inclusion Initiatives at Universitas Jambi

UNJA promotes inclusivity through the Unit Layanan Disabilitas (Disability Services Unit), offering ramps and adaptive tech. Gender initiatives target 30% female faculty in STEM via scholarships. Programs like Beasiswa UNJA support indigenous Papuan and remote area students/staff. Cultural events celebrate Jambi's Melayu heritage, fostering an equitable environment. Partnerships with ASEAN universities enhance international diversity.

⚖️ Work-Life Balance and Campus Life

UNJA supports balance with 40-hour weeks, annual leave (12+ days), health insurance (BPJS), and child care. Campus perks include sports fields, mosques, cafeterias with local Jambi cuisine (gulai ikan patin), and riverside trails. Jambi's low-cost living (IDR 5-10M/month) and proximity to rainforests offer relaxation. Faculty events like seminars and family days build community.
